  • Nicaragua Finca San Antonio

    Nicaragua, dubbed the "land of lakes and volcanoes," boasts exceptional coffee due to its diverse microclimates and fertile soils. Coffee's journey began with Spanish colonists in the 1800s, establishing it in regions like Las Segovias, Matagalpa, and Jinotega, celebrated for their volcanic terrain. Despite historical challenges, including political unrest and Hurricane Mitch, cooperative efforts emerged, breathing life into the industry. Today, coffee sustains around 45,000 families and constitutes 8% of Nicaragua's exports. The majority of growers are smallholders who tend to coffee alongside staple crops like corn and beans. Notably, almost 95% of Nicaraguan coffee thrives beneath the shade of native and exotic trees, fostering biodiversity and soil health. At Finca San Antonio, nestled in the Matagalpa region, coffee is cultivated in harmony with nature. The farm's agroforestry systems protect cloud forests and local wildlife, resulting in high-quality beans. In fact, an Obata Natural from Finca San Antonio earned recognition in the Nicaragua Cup of Excellence, underlining the success of this sustainable approach.
